Client Job Description: Responsible for program management of the WAF initiative inside the security organization. WAF empowers Client Security to detect, respond and virtually patch critical zero-day vulnerabilities and guide the Security Organization in building well-informed detection and prevention capabilities. The focus for the program manager is to define the program scope, partner with stakeholders on the plan and drive the execution. In addition, the program manager is in charge of handling information flow and resolving interdependencies (inside and outside of the Security organization), providing status reports for broader communication including the key stakeholders. In addition, combine various data sources together and roll up information effectively in weekly reports and present in the governance meetings.
Skills *
• Strong stakeholder management skills. Ability to communicate effectively and concisely with all levels of internal and external stakeholders (including VP level) with evidence and data.
• Strong ability to manage at a program level in terms of scoping, planning, risk, dependencies and execution with multiple workstreams underneath.
• Can simplify and structure a complex technical program effectively.
• Excellent communication and presentation skills, both verbal and written in English
• Technical expertise in web application security domain:
o Proficiency in Web Application Firewall (WAF) technologies, including a thorough understanding of WAF architecture, deployment options, and policy configuration best practices to effectively manage the protection of web applications from security threats.
o Solid understanding of web application security principles and best practices, such as the OWASP Top Ten vulnerabilities, to ensure effective communication, collaboration, and guidance for security and development teams.
o Familiarity with web application architecture and development, including frontend and backend technologies, APIs, and network protocols, to facilitate informed decision-making and coordination between teams implementing WAF solutions.
o Working knowledge of containerization and Kubernetes orchestration, with a focus on understanding how WAF solutions can be deployed and managed in a containerized environment to ensure seamless integration and effective security measures.
• Nice to have:
o Experience in managing relevant compliance requirements and standards (e.g., PCI DSS, GDPR), ensuring that web application security measures align with organizational policies, industry best practices, and applicable regulations.
